Transfers - Man Utd have gone contract crazy with a new manager and several big signings - still no Pogba which is a transfer that baffles me. He looks like a worldy, but also has games that completely pass him by. A transfer that's likely to surpass £150m when you factor in agent's fees, wages & bonuses just strikes me as a completely daft thing to do. You could easily buy 3 players for that money who might not reach the same peak, but would improve the squad and allow for a more consistent level of form. Think about that - 3 £50m players and what that'd buy! What if Pogba does his ACL in September? I know it's not my money but it just seems a bizarrely extravagant signing.
